Немного поправил:

In Kazakhstan certification bodies and testing laboratories are market entities accredited by the national accreditation body. Certification bodies issue certificates, labs conduct tests and issue test reports. No one is authorized to carry out certification singlehandedly. According to our information, certification is carried out by AFNOR. We have the following questions: 1) Is it in conformity with the French law and the requirements of international standards to have one entity to combine the functions of the National Authority for Standardization and the Certification Authority? Would that not lead to a conflict of interest in this case? 2) What kind of certification does AFNOR conduct? (Certification of all products or only of some sensitive products?). 3) Whether AFNOR tests were carried out for the purposes of certification, or only to check the test records and issue a certificate based on the results of the analysis? 4) Who is authorized (notified) and how do the rights of the AFNOR certification work? Is AFNOR the only body which conducts such work?

Thank you!
